Why is a checklist important?

Why is a checklist important?

It helps people stay more organized, assuring them they will not skip any important step in the process. A checklist motivates us to take action and complete tasks. Small wins and the goal-gradient effect encourage us to reach our goals. Checklists help us move quickly, be more efficient, and save time.

How effective is a checklist?

Following through a checklist means less stress and fewer drills. By mastering all the tedious, repetitive tasks, you’ll be able to utilize more of your focus and brainpower for creative activities. With more free time and fewer things on your mind, you will be able to think more clearly.

What is checklist and its uses?

A checklist is a list of items you need to verify, check or inspect. Checklists are used in every imaginable field — from building inspections to complex medical surgeries. Using a checklist allows you to ensure you don’t forget any important steps.

    How do you make an effective checklist?

    5 Tips for Creating Great Checklists

    1. Structure it logically. A good quality checklist guides the user.
    2. Make questions simple and unbiased. Every question in a checklist needs to be understood by its user.
    3. Clarify the objective.
    4. Provide help and guidance.
    5. Emphasise the right questions.

    What is the purpose of inspection?

    To inspect is to carefully examine. The main objective of inspection is to meet customer requirements, wants, and needs. The objective is to prevent defective product flowing down the successive operations and prevent loss to the company. Many characteristics cannot be inspected at the final stage of production.

  • What is the purpose of a checklist?

    Checklists are useful for applying methodology. A checklist is a type of job aid used to reduce failure by compensating for potential limits of human memory and attention. It helps to ensure consistency and completeness in carrying out a task. A basic example is the “to do list”.
